Change the equations to general form:
ax2 + bx+c=0
1. (x-2)(x + 4) = 3(x - 1)

Answer:

x² - x - 5 = 0

Step-by-step explanation:

[tex]\sf (x-2)(x+4)=3(x-1)[/tex]

[tex]\implies \sf x(x) + x(4) + (-2)(x)+(-2)(4)=3(x) + 3(-1)[/tex]

[tex]\implies \sf x^2 + 4x - 2x - 8 = 3x - 3[/tex]

[tex]\implies \sf x^2 + 2x - 8 = 3x - 3[/tex]

[tex]\implies \sf (x^2 + 2x - 8) - (3x-3) =3x-3-(3x-3)[/tex]

[tex]\implies \sf x^2 + 2x - 8 - 3x + 3 = 0[/tex]

[tex]\implies \sf x^2 + 2x - 3x -8 + 3 = 0[/tex]

[tex]\implies \boxed{\boxed{\sf x^2 - x - 5 = 0}}[/tex]
